Technical
Information (Hardware/Software)
- What sort of computer do I need?
You need a PC with Windows 95, 98, NT or 2000. You also need a sound
card and microphone, a modem and a connection to the Internet. You may
also need a printer if you want to print exercises. At the moment Interactive
English does not function on Macintosh computers or other operating
systems.
- What software do I need?
You need an Internet browser (Netscape or Microsoft Explorer), email
software (Eudora or Outlook Express) and some chat software (Netmeeting,
mIRC or ICQ).
